- wild yam taken from ovulation to cycle day 1 has been known to assist lengthening the luteal phase
- flax seed or flax oil can help relieve constipation during pregnancy and is an essential fatty acid
- red raspberry tea/infusion is helpful for pre-conception and pregnancy

CD 6 (cycle day 6)
I've done some research and decided to change just a few things this cycle:
- Take the herb evening primrose oil through the day of ovulation (it can possibly cause contractions so you shouldn't take after ovulation). EPO helps PMS symptoms and also our fertile "egg white cervical mucus."
- Take vitamin B6. It possibly regulates hormones in a cycle and does something to help our metabolism work more efficiently.
- Start my prenatal vitamins earlier (today).
- "Baby dance" every other day instead of every day around ovulation. ;-)
